PROFICIENCY IN FAST RESCUE BOATS

Course Outlone

Total Days - 4 Working Days

Total hour - 25 Hours

Aim

This training course aims to meet the mandatory minimum requirements for seafarers for proficiency in fast rescue boats in accordance with the Regulation VI/2, Section A-VI/2, paragraphs 7-12 and Table A-VI/2-2of the STCW 1978 Convention, as amended and the STCW Code.

Scope & Objective

To demonstrate the knowledge, skills and abilities to operate a fast rescue boat, always ensuring the safety of the personnel and the ship, corresponding to Regulation VI/2, Section A-VI/2, paragraphs 7-12 and Table A-VI/2-2of the STCW 1978 Convention, as amended and its STCW Code.

Teaching Medium

English

Entry Standards

The participant shall have:

  • Valid medical certificate.
  • Current basic safety course certificates.
  • Course of proficiency in survival craft and rescue boats other than fast rescue boats.

Medical Standard

As per M.S (Medical Examination for seafarers) Rules 2000 as amended from time to time.

Course Certificate

Upon successful completion of the course, the participant must receive a course completion document for "Proficiency in Fast Rescue Boats”, in accordance with the Regulation VI/2, Section A-VI/2, paragraphs 7-12 and Table A-VI/2-2of the STCW 1978 Convention, as amended and the STCW Code.
